How Each Ascendant Moves Through the World

• Taurus — slow, grounded, and deliberate movement

• Gemini — fast-moving, spontaneous, always shifting direction

• Cancer — slow, cautious, moving with emotional awareness

• Leo — high-vibe movement, naturally drawn toward the spotlight

• Virgo — precise, practical, intentional in every step

• Libra — stylish, chic, moving with grace and fairness

• Scorpio — slow, deep, and intensely intentional

• Sagittarius — high-vibe, “do what you want” movement, following the sunset

• Capricorn — slow movement with a consistent, disciplined approach

• Aquarius — fast-moving, future-focused, creating what’s next

• Pisces — slow, flowing, intuitive movement — inspiring and releasing
